I'm a nurse and I want to share a clinical perspective on the GI side effects. What's happening in your gut during the first few weeks is the medication slowing gastric emptying significantly. This is by design — it's the mechanism that creates satiety. The nausea is your body adjusting to this new normal. It gets better as your body adapts.
